| Radio frequency identification(RFID)technology is a technology that realizes contactless identification through the mutual coupling of wireless radio frequency signals.With the rapid development of the Internet of Things technology,RFID electronic tag is widely used in various fields because of its non-contact,low cost,long identification distance and large storage capacity.However,the security and privacy issues of RFID systems are becoming increasingly prominent.At present,in all strategies to ensure the security of RFID systems,reliable security protocols have become one of the key technologies.In this paper,based on the terminal of the Internet of things that require high power consumption and have limited computing power,the ultra-lightweight authentication protocol of RFID is studied.Firstly,this paper introduces some basic knowledge of RFID technology,including radio frequency communication system and RFID system components.And then the security threats such as tampering,eavesdropping,and denial of service attacks on RFID systems are studied.The security requirements such as data confidentiality,label anonymity,forward and backward security,etc.are presented.Then,according to the actual security requirements,an ultra-lightweight RFID authentication protocol based on Per operation function was proposed.Using shift,XOR operations and function of bit operations,the protocol has achieved anonymity of the identity of the communication both sides and met security requirements.In addition,the back-end database storing the current and previous authentication information,and with designing of the time stamp,the protocol can effectively resist denial of service and desynchronization attacks.BAN logic is used to prove its completeness.And the simulation model is built with OPNET software.After analysis and comparison,After analysis and comparison,the new protocol has good security advantages.Finally,according to the current status of smart manhole cover locks,a smart manhole cover lock terminal based on NB-IoT and RFID technology is designed.The terminal mainly implements two functions: real-time tilt monitoring of the manhole cover and the key with permission to unlock.The hardware composition and software design of each module of the lock end and the key end are described in detail.And a switch lock algorithm based on the RFID protocol is designed.The key end and the lock end realize the switch lock by RFID authentication.The test results show that the intelligent manhole cover lock terminal based on the protocol in this paper can keep good operation,which verifies the practicability of the protocol. |